    Zaionc, M., λ-Definability on free algebras, Annals of Pure and Applied Logic 51 279-300. A λ-language over a simple type structure is considered. There is a natural isomorphism which identifies free algebras with nonempty second-order types. If A is a free algebra determined by the signature SA = [α1,...,αn], then by a type τA we mean τ1,...,τn→0 where τi=0αi→0. It can be seen that closed terms of the type τA reflex constructions in the algebra A. Therefore any term of the (...)

    Bell’s theorem cannot be proved if complementary measurements have to be represented by random variables which cannot be added or multiplied. One such case occurs if their domains are not identical. The case more directly related to the Einstein–Rosen–Podolsky argument occurs if there exists an ‘element of reality’ but nevertheless addition of complementary results is impossible because they are represented by elements from different arithmetics. A naive mixing of arithmetics leads to contradictions at a much more elementary level than the (...)
